UNUSUAL COMEDY AT EVERYBODY’S.

“The Fair Co-Ed," which heads the current bill at Everybody’s Theatre, is a. hilarious comedy of college life. The picture was adapted from George Ade's musical comedy under the direction of Sam “’ood, who has been respOnsible for so many fine comedy productions. Marion Davies has the role of an athletic college girl. and she plays the part with great success. Support: ing Miss Davies in the leading role is Johnnie Mack Brown, as Bob, a former star of an American university football team. The second attraction. ” The Uliuging Vine." is a sparkling comedy of the most popular type. The picture was adapted for the screen from Zelda Sear's successful musical comedy, am‘ has been splendidly handled by the master producer, Cecil B. de Mills.
